Tender description

Prequalification & Short Listing. Cork County Council wish to procure a contractor to construct a Proposed Housing Scheme. The proposed scheme (Phase 1) comprises of 49 No housing units, complete with associated site development and infrastructural works at Kilnagleary Carrigaline, Co. Cork. The housing mix comprises 28no two beds, 16no three beds and 5no four beds in terraced format.
